Crossed Keys Estate is seeking experienced bartenders for luxury wedding venue. Enthusiastic candidates wanted, must be motivated and able to work in a fast paced environment during events with up to 300 guests. Candidate should be willing to contribute ideas to bar menus. Bartender Role:Provide guests at events with exceptional beverage service, maintaining the highest standards of hospitality Interact with customers, take orders, and serve drinks Assess customers' needs and make recommendations Check ID's and confirm that customer is of legal drinking age Restock and replenish bar supplies Present excellent customer service Comply with all food and beverage regulations Maintain a clean and organized bar area, ensuring all supplies and equipment are readily available Report to wedding Maitre D' & Business Owners Adhere to responsible alcohol service guidelines and ensure guest safety Qualifications Must be available at least 1-2 days per week (nights and weekends) Working knowledge of drink service and bar terminology Must be proficient in setting up and breaking down/cleaning bar equipment Strong attention to detail and organizational skills Compensation: $16.00 per hour Our HistoryTHE VISION FOR CROSSED KEYS ESTATE BEGAN OVER 30 YEARS AGO WITH KATHERINE AND CELSO RODRIGUEZBlending Katherine's love for planning and Celso's passion for food, the Rodriguez family began their legacy of thoughtfully curated milestone events centered around meals worth remembering.
